Thought I had it nailed. When I first lost my power I checked the overflow valve and found the spring cracked. Replaced overflow valve@77 bucks. Truck ran fine for about 100 miles and then boom,no power again. Checked the valve ,it was ok. What next guys?
 
I would be checking the fuel shut off solinoid and it's relays.

Some times they only pull up 3/4 and will run but have low power.

You nailed it Ted. It felt like the solenoid was opening up in steps. After reaching in and working it open by hand and taking it for a ride,it runs like its old self again. When I went to shut it down,piecesof the solenoid fell out from under the hood:rolleyes: . I'll try to put it back together . If that wont work,I saw a post awhile back on a manual shut down using a cable. Sounds simple enough to me.
